At the top of each project or product homepage, and on the top banner of each page where the project name appears, you should include a "TM" symbol next to the *first* main occurrence of the "Apache Foo" project name. This highlights our trademark claim and emphasizes its importance to us. Logos are important to recognize as trademarks as well. For the project's official logo (if it has one, and especially if it uses the ASF feather), ensure that it includes a small "TM" symbol in the graphic or immediately adjacent to it. For pages that include the project logo on them, ensure you mention "... and the Project logo are trademarks..." in the attribution.
